Chapter 3 Who Means

Shi Chunfen hurried to the door of the mansion, but he was afraid that he would be too anxious and seemed to be questioning Chu Ling, so he naturally slowed down.

Li Yan happened to catch up with her and pulled her forward, "Grandma is not looking for the uncle. The carriage has left and she won't wait for anyone!"

Chu Ling had already got into the carriage and was waiting for Lang Hao to bring the rest of his luggage. In the past, he did not like to open the curtain when riding in a carriage because his appearance was too flamboyant. Many people would regard him as a beautiful scenery and surround him.

He pointed at the carriage, but for some reason today, he rolled up the curtains early and looked out of the carriage from time to time, as if waiting for something.

His eyes were carefree and lazy, and full of scrutiny of the world. It wasn't until the spring equinox broke into his eyes that his long, narrow and deep eyes seemed to have suddenly found a focus, following her every step.

There are women in this world, some are gentle, some are dignified, some are cold, some are charming, but they are all incompetent, and they almost have no temperament of their own, but it is such a woman who has unknowingly become his fetters.

As soon as Chu Ling closed his eyes, he saw Shi Chunfen timidly calling him "uncle" last night. This feeling made him want to stop. He rubbed his brows and tried to suppress the heat in his heart.

But this heat has not only shown no signs of easing, it seems to be getting more intense.

Chu Ling had to put down the car curtain in embarrassment and said in a deep voice: "Let's go."

There was a driver guarding the carriage all the time. Hearing what the master said, although he was a little confused about why he suddenly set off early, he didn't dare to talk too much. He quickly got into the carriage and rode the horse, and rushed out with a "drive" sound.

As soon as the carriage moved, Shi Chunfen and Li Yan knew something was wrong. They quickened their pace and chased after him, but they still couldn't catch up.

Li Yan was fine, he didn't have any extra thoughts, he just looked at Shi Chunquin with pity.

The spring equinox was extremely uncomfortable, and her brain suddenly stopped thinking. On the second day of the wedding, the husband left her and ran away without any regrets, without even leaving a word. How would the people in the house view her in the future?

Shi Chunfen did not dare to blame Chu Ling. She only blamed herself for being stupid and somehow offending the uncle, causing his attitude to change overnight.

They were obviously so gentle last night, so why did Chu Ling change his appearance this morning?

Shi Chunfen thought hard and didn't know what she had done wrong. She just thought that she was too stupid and was as lifeless as a piece of wood last night, which made the man tasteless, so she lost interest.

The more she thought about it, the more she felt like this, and she felt very upset. Obviously, the day before the wedding, Mrs. Xi showed her those picture albums, but she was too shy and didn't look through them more. She didn't dare to move last night, which naturally disappointed her uncle.

Lang Hao hurried over with his luggage on his back, and was a little confused when he saw this scene. The uncle promised to wait for him, but where is he now?!

The news that Chun Equinox went to Huating when Chu Ling was left behind quickly spread throughout Chu's house. Naturally, the old lady also received the news, and she couldn't help but complain about Chu Yan.

"Is it your idea for A Ling to go to Huating? His wife can't coax him, so he has to send his son to go out. Look at your achievements!"

Chu Yan chuckled and said with a dry smile: "Son, isn't this just for the sake of our Chu family's face? Qingqing is the head of Huating County, and her long stay in Huating will inevitably lead to speculation. If the news reaches the ears of the Kyoto Emperor, he will think that our Chu family

A person below the family has wronged his superiors and wronged the head of Huating County. Isn’t that true?”

The old lady snorted coldly and said displeasedly: "You brought it upon yourself to be convicted! With our family background, how can we marry the daughter of a wealthy scholar's family and not be able to marry him? You have to go to the head of Huating County to marry someone else."

As a result, now you have to look at her face when marrying your daughter-in-law!"

The word "Gao Pan" was a bit too strong. Chu Yan touched his nose awkwardly and muttered: "But Qingqing is right to be annoyed. What a noble son A Ling is, there is no one in Liuzhou who can choose him."

Two of them, even if they were sent to Kyoto, they would be very rare, I don’t understand..." He hesitated to say the next words.

But even if he didn't say it, the old lady understood what he meant.

He didn't understand why the old lady had so many choices to choose from, but she chose the most unpopular child bride.

Originally, the wealthy scholar families like them did not have the custom of raising children and wives. This was an idea thought up by a small family who could not afford the betrothal gift and looked down on country girls. The wealthy scholar family did this, but it was a joke. But

Ten years ago, an eminent monk passed by the Chu family and calculated that the Chu family would suffer a great disaster. It happened that things were not going well for the Chu family at that time. I dared not believe it. The eminent monk said that it would not be difficult to resolve this disaster. All he had to do was to bring back two children from the poor family.

With a child bride, you can control the house and eliminate disasters.

This is not a difficult task for the Chu family. In addition, there are many concubines in the house. No one will object to using the marriage of two concubines in exchange for the prosperity of the entire family.

Therefore, the old lady took the initiative and brought back two child brides, one named Shi Chunfen and the other Ji Xiaoman.

Perhaps even the old lady herself never thought that one of the two girls she randomly selected would marry her most beloved grandson.

When this matter was mentioned, the old lady sighed and said, "In your opinion, when a man marries a wife, does he care about family status, appearance, talent, character or heart?"

Chu Yan was stunned. Although he didn't understand why the old lady asked this, he still answered honestly: "Of course, the heart is the most important, followed by family background, followed by character. Talent and appearance are not important considerations."

He answered seriously and was not pretending to be arrogant.

As the saying goes, food and color are the nature of food. There is no man or woman in the world who does not covet color.

But for young men from scholarly families like them, beautiful women are too easy to obtain, and talent is not a must-have quality for women. Therefore, when choosing a mistress, you still have to choose someone with high family status and good character, but in the end

The most important thing is that it must be what you want, otherwise it is not the best solution to get married and get bored with each other and have an uneasy family.

"Yes." The old lady nodded with satisfaction, "You all know that the most important thing in marrying a wife is to suit your own preferences, so what's wrong with me choosing a wife who suits A Ling's liking?"

"What?" Even Chu Yan was a little shocked now, "Is it Aling's own wish to marry that girl?"

The old lady raised her eyebrows and said angrily: "What else? Do you really think that my mother is so stupid that she doesn't even care about A Ling's future?"

Chu Yan immediately lowered his head and said, "I know I was wrong."

In fact, it's no wonder that he thought wrongly. Before Chu Ling got married, many beautiful women threw themselves into his arms, but he didn't take a second look at it. He even resolutely refused the girl who was necessary for the prince's sexual intercourse.

Anyone who looks at him will think that he is not a womanizer, so how would they think that he already has a crush on him?

Although Chu Yan didn't understand why Chu Ling was interested in Shi Chun Equinox, he knew his son's temperament. Once he decided something, ten horses couldn't pull him back, otherwise he wouldn't have spent so much time begging the old lady.

Here, let her come forward to set the time for the vernal equinox.

The old lady just loved her son and grandson so much that she would rather bear the infamy than go along with his wishes.

Thinking of this, Chu Yan respected the old lady even more.

"Now that A Ling's matter has been settled, you parents, don't always feel unwilling." The old lady warned: "I have talked with her about the Spring Equinox child. Although there is nothing extraordinary about her, she is an honest person.

Yes, as the saying goes, seeking a virtuous wife is a good thing. You already have a powerful mother-in-law at home, so having multiple honest wives is not a bad thing."

Seeing that the old lady stepped on his wife again, covertly and covertly, Chu Yan's face froze and he said with a smile: "My son knows."
